Cross-Cultural Similarities
Aspects or elements of human behavior, values, or social norms that are found to be consistent or comparable across different cultures.
Evolutionary Perspective
The theory that seeks to identify behavior that is a result of our genetic inheritance from our ancestors.
Mate Selection
The process of choosing a partner for reproduction and companionship, influenced by biological, psychological, and social factors.
Fatuous Love
A type of love characterized by commitment based on passion without the intimacy component, often considered to be shallow.
